The East Godavari visit of Mr. Nara Chandrababu Naidu, the President of the Telugu Desam Party (TDP) turned chaotic, after a clash with the police.

On the 6th of May, Saturday, Mr. Nara Chandrababu Naidu visited S.Muppavaram in Chagallu Mandal, East Godavari district, where he experienced a tense encounter with local police.  His visit was a part of an initiative to extend support to the farmers of the regiohn, who lost their crops due to heavy rainfall in the Telugu State of Andhra Pradesh.  During an interaction with the farmers, the police attempted to hasten the convoy of Mr. Nara Chandrababu Naidu, leading to a heated exchange between the officers and the TDP supporters.

During the confrontation, Mr. Nara Chandrababu Naidu strongly criticized the police force’s handling of the situation. The TDP supporters voiced their discontent by shouting slogans against the police, accusing them of mistreatment and insensitivity to the farmers’ concerns.

Meanwhile, the TDP supporters and leaders alleged the ruling Yuvajana Sramika Rythu Congress Party (YSRCP) Government, for using the police force as a puppet to harass the opposition.  Furthermore, Mr. Nara Chandrababu Naidu urged Mr. Y.S. Jagan Mohan Reddy, the Chief Minister of Andhra Pradesh, to look into the problems of the farmers, who lost their crops due to rain and provide an assistance.
